The Communications team builds our brand and influence across the world. We're looking for someone to join our small—but high-leverage—Corporate Communications team, which shapes and protects our reputation across the financial, policy, and global business communities.
We're looking for an experienced communicator to build and lead a proactive corporate storytelling program. You'll be the connective tissue across the business and policy audiences—building the campaigns, relationships, and moments that shape how the companies that rely on our products the most, and those who write the rules of the economy Stripe is helping to build, understand Stripe.
You'll lead our most influential reputational programs globally—high-profile events, executive media and speaking opportunities, and proactive campaigns that demonstrate our economic impact. At the same time, you'll work closely with our policy team—advocating for improvements in financial policy and regulation, while also shaping our response to complex policy issues.
